
Trump Hosts King Charles: State Visit Highlights U.S.-U.K. Ties
About this episode
President Trump hosts King Charles III and Queen Camilla for a state visit, marking the first of his second term. The visit, from April 27th to 30th, celebrates the U.S.-U.K. alliance, with a grand South Lawn ceremony, Oval Office talks, and a state dinner. The trip underscores the enduring bond between the two nations as America approaches its 250th independence anniversary.

President Trump is rolling out the red carpet for King Charles III and Queen Camilla with a full-state visit to Washington, D.C. kicking off. April 27th in Rapping, April 30th. This marks the first official state visit of his second term, complete with all the formal trimmings like ceremonies and a big state dinner. The trip highlights the deep ties between the U.S. and the U.K., timed right as America nears its 250th anniversary of independence. White House folks say it's all about honoring that special alliance that's held strong for generations. Folks are buzzing about the scale, especially the South Lawn arrival ceremony Tuesday morning, featuring a 21-gun salute, Marine Band Tooms, and service members from every branch of the military lining up something new for these visits. Trump and King Charles will huddle in the Oval Office for key talks while Melania and Camilla link up with students on education and culture swaps.
Evening brings that fancy state dinner to cap the day. Expect a formal send-off Thursday morning, setting the states for even tighter U.S. U.K. bonds moving forward.
